In 1836, Alexander William Hall entered the world in Aberdeen, Brown, Ohio, born to William Hall And Jane Ann Lee. In 1850, Alexander William Hall resided in Aberdeen, Brown, Ohio, USA. In 1860, Alexander William Hall resided in Huntington, Brown, Ohio. Alexander William Hall married Hannah Evans, Sarah A Sallie Lancaster, and had children including Charles A Hall, Clara B Hall, Everett E Hall, Frances Agnes Hall, George Bailey Hall, Lee Hall, Lucy B Hall, Martha Hall, Mary Ann Hall, Maud Hall, Myrtle B Hall, Omar Louis Hall, Phoebe Jane Hall, Thomas William Hall. Alexander William Hall passed away in 1911 in Hamilton, Butler County, Ohio, United States of America.
